Property description
Welcome to 60 Heintzman Street #1715, nestled in the heart of The Junction! This bright and spacious 2-bedroom, 2-bathroom unit offers 2 parking spots and 2 lockers, all with low maintenance fees. Featuring an open-concept design, the functional split-bedroom layout maximizes space and storage. The kitchen boasts stainless steel appliances and a convenient breakfast bar with granite countertops, perfect for dining. The living area leads to a private balcony with south-facing views, ready for your personal touch. The primary bedroom includes a walk-in closet and a 4-piece ensuite with a deep soaker tub, while the secondary bedroom features large windows and ample light. Enjoy exceptional building amenities such as a concierge, garden terrace with BBQ, children's playroom, study, and gym. Located steps from the TTC, UP Express, High Park, trendy Junction shops, cafes, restaurants, and Stockyards, this unit is your perfect urban retreat. **EXTRAS** *Listing contains virtually staged photos* Monthly condo fee includes all maintenance to building. Both bedrooms have custom blinds. Unit professionally cleaned and painted November 2024.
